【嵌套的if语句,干净的代码,并且是Python风格的,带有控制器/键盘输入】教程文章相关的互联网学习教程文章

python通过什么划分语句块【图】

python通过什么划分语句块?python是通过缩进格式来划分语句块的。语句是编程中的基本构成单元。 Python语句与语句块,缩进Python的语句不同于C++等编程语言。Python的语句末尾不需要加分号表示语句结束,直接换行即可。另外很重要的一点,就是使用缩进表示语句块之间的逻辑关系,而不用大括号。这两个特点既保持代码可读性,又减少符号输入提高效率,懒人最爱Python缩进缩进的空格数目可变,但统一代码块内相应语句要保持一致,否则...

python语句用什么符号隔开【图】

python语句分隔:可以使用语法括号对,在括号对里语句可以横跨数行,也可以使用反斜杠结尾起到相同效果,也可以使用小括号进行分隔,字符常量有特殊的规则,可以使用三对单引号分隔。1、如果使用语法括号对,语句就可以横跨数行列表:>>> a=[2,3,4] >>> b=[1,2,3,] >>> a [2,3,4] >>> b [1, 2, 3] >>>字典:>>> c={a:1,b:2,c:3} >>> d={a:1,b:2,c:3} >>> c {a: 1, b: 2, c: 3} >>> c {a: 1, b: 2, c: 3} >>> d {a: 1, b: 2, c: 3} ...

pythonfor循环语句怎么写【图】

python for循环语句怎么写?Python for循环可以遍历任何序列的项目,如一个列表或者一个字符串。for循环的语法格式如下:for iterating_var in sequence:statements(s)实例:#!/usr/bin/python # -*- coding: UTF-8 -*-for letter in Python: # 第一个实例print 当前字母 :, letterfruits = [banana, apple, mango] for fruit in fruits: # 第二个实例print 当前水果 :, fruitprint "Good bye!"以上实例输出结果:当前字...

python以什么划分语句块【图】

语句块是在条件为真(条件语句)时执行或者执行多次(循环语句)的一组语句;在代码前放置空格来缩进语句即可创建语句块,语句块中的每行必须是同样的缩进量;(推荐学习:Python视频教程)缩进:Python开发者有意让违反了缩进规则的程序不能通过编译,以此来强制程序员养成良好的编程习惯;Python语言利用缩进表示语句块的开始和退出(Off-side规则),而非使用花括号或者某种关键字;增加缩进表示语句块的开始,而减少缩进则表示...

python中怎么连写两个print语句【图】

print函数在python2中,print只是一个关键字,但是在3.x中,print 是一个函数。定义: print(*objects, sep= , end=\n, file=sys.stdout);参数: *objects-复数,一次可输出多个对象,用‘,’分开 sep – 用来间隔多个对象,默认值是一个空格。 end --用来设定以什么结尾。默认值是换行符 \n,可以换成其他字符串。 file – 要写入的文件对象。无返回值。所以想要把多个输出放在同一行,只需要设定end的内容即可。一个例子:print...

python常见语句汇总【图】

在我们学习python的过程中,会遇到一些我们经常遇到的语句,下面我将这些语句盘点一下,方便大家记忆。相关推荐:《python视频》python常用语句:(1)、赋值:创建变量引用值a,b,c=aa,bb,cc(2)、调用:执行函数log.write(spam,name)打印、输出:调用打印对象,print 语句print (abc)(3)if、elif、else:选择条件语句,if语句、else与elif语句 if iplaypython in text:print (text)(4)for、else:序列迭代 for x in list:pri...

python有switch语句吗【图】

python没有switch-case语句,官方文档介绍可以用if-elseif-elseif代替。同时也用其他的解决方案,比较简单的就是利用字典来实现同样的功能。写一个字典,每个key对应的值是一个方法。如switch = {"valueA":functionA,"valueB":functionB,"valueC":functionC}调用时可以像这样try:switch["value"]() #执行相应的方法。 except KeyError as e:pass 或 functionX #执行default部分简单代码如下:switch = {"a":lambda x:x*2,"b":lambd...

python语言基本语句有什么【图】

python语句与语法1.python简单语句的基本介绍>>> while True: #简单的while循环 ... reply = input(Enter text:) #调用了Input,将输入传参给reply ... if reply == stop: break #如果输入的是stop就退出循环 ... print(reply.upper()) #如果输入的不是stop就一直将输入的转换为大写字母 ... Enter text:abc #这是第一个输入abc,看到下面转换成大写的ABC了 ABC Enter text:nihao123da NIHAO123DA Enter text:sto...

python赋值语句是什么【图】

赋值语句Python中,主要赋值运算符是等号( = ) 赋值不是直接将一个值赋给一个变量,对象是通过引用传递的。不管变量是新创建的还是已经存在的,都是将该对象的引用赋值给变量。C语言中,赋值语句可以当成一个表达式,可以返回值。但在Python中,赋值语句不会返回值。这使得这样的语句是非法的>>> y = (x = x + 1) # assignments not expressions! File "<stdin>", line 1y = (x = x + 1)^SyntaxError: invalid syntax>>> if (a = 3...

pythn用for语句求1加到100【图】

用python实现从1加到100,可使用for循环语句。定义一个函数def sumStartToEnd(start,end):sum = 0for n in range(start,end+1,1):sum = sum + nreturn sum print(sumStartToEnd(1,100))输出结果5050还可以使用while循环来实现def sum(): sum = 0 x=1 while x < 101: sum = sum + x x+=1 return sum print(sum())结果是一样的5050更多python相关技术文章,请访问python教程学习。以上就是pythn用for语句求1加到100的详细内容,更多请...

Python中用什么代替switch语句【图】

python中建议大家用if..elif...else来代替switch语句。如果分类实在太多,官方建议在函数里面构造字典映射,然后call function(value)来解决。例如另一种更简单的方法是用lambda匿名函数来代替function以上就是Python中用什么代替switch语句的详细内容,更多请关注Gxl网其它相关文章!

python赋值语句怎么写【图】

python赋值语句的形式1、基本赋值2.元组赋值运算(位置)3.列表赋值运算(位置)4、多目标赋值运算,共享引用以上就是python赋值语句怎么写的详细内容,更多请关注Gxl网其它相关文章!

python的if语句怎么写【图】

今天给大家分享一下Python中的IF语句的使用首先我们看一个IF语句处理的流程图:IF语句运行原理就是:给出条件,决定下一步怎么做?如果条件为真,就执行决策条件代码块的内容,为假就退出。我们学习之前先看下Python中的真假:在python中,任何非零,非空对象都是真,除真和None以外其他的都是假。来敲一下笔记:1、任何非零和非空对象都为真 解释为True2、数字0、空对象和特殊对象None均为假 解释为False3、比较和相等测试会应用到...

python怎么删除语句【图】

有朋友问在Python中如何实现删除语句。实际上,有三种方法,分别是:del语句,pop()方法,remove()方法。下面将给大家做详细介绍。一、del语句如果知道要删除的元素在列表中的位置,可使用 del 语句。使用 del 可删除任何位置处的列表元素,条件是知道其索引。举个栗子:motorcycles = [honda, yamaha, suzuki] print(motorcycles) del motorcycles[1] print(motorcycles)用 del 语句将值从列表中删除后,你就无法再访问它了。二、...

python判断语句怎么写【图】

前面我们学习了Python的数据类型和相关知识,现在可以开始编写Python程序了,首先从if条件判断开始。Python程序语言指定任何非0和非空(null)值为true,0 或者 null为false。Python 编程中 if 语句用于控制程序的执行,基本形式为:举个栗子,我们定义一个变量age,它的值是30,接下来用if来判断它是否>=18,此时if语句表达式为真,else语句省略。如下在Python语言中,条件结构由if—else语句构成,else语句也可以省略。if语句由三部...

输入 - 相关标签